Benefits of Deprescribing

SSRIs can be helpful, even life-saving, for some. But for many others, their negative side effects and lack of efficacy leave clients feeling stuck - staying on them doesn’t make them feel better but when they try to get off they feel worse.

Mona Adamszek, psychiatric nurse practitioner, specializes in ‘deprescribing’, the process of slowly titrating along with lifestyle changes to help you get through the withdrawal symptoms. Adding nutritional and nutraceutical changes, with guidance from Cyndi, can make this process easier.
